    I thought you might have a ranking system that wasn't binary.
    Something where you assigned a number between one and ten for each condition that might aid in choosing one stock over another when you have several at 90% and not enough capital to take a full position in all of them.

    It's an idea but maybe a bit too much...

    The issue that you describe is exactly what I face right now, but instead of looking for the one that is the most perfect, I prefer looking at its character like recent volatility or if the stock has a tendency to just make bumps with deep retracements and also look at the fundamentals, etc, just trying to have an educated opinion like, you know, I like this one, that one a bit less, you get the idea.

    You might consider giving more wieght to those conditions rather than having a binary system.
    Instead of is it in an uptrend, yes or no, you look at the slope of the uptrend and give it a value based on your opinion of how the stock is moving. Mabe based in the distance from a moving average or how symmetrical the stacked ma's are.

    Chewy, Inc. (CHWY) - Retail - Internet (Open)
    Operates as an online retailer of pet food and other pet-related products and services. It supplies pet medications, food, treats and other pet-health products and services for dogs, cats, fish, birds, small pets, horses, and reptiles.

    Trade Checklist Score - Timing, fundamentals and pattern quality.
    The stock scores 90% which is OK for a long trade tentative.

    One negative is that I came a bit late and entered beyond my ideal entry point which is just above breakout level so I increased my Stop Loss to 7.5% risk but I will be closely following it and eventually close earlier if the action is weak and if there is no follow through.
